Binomial nomenclature also called binominal nomenclature or binary nomenclature comes ditrectly from the Latin Language.
In latin, the translation would be
Binomial: two-term
Nomenclature: naming system
It is a formal system of naming species of living things by giving each a name composed of two parts, both of which use Latin grammatical forms. Species were named mainly according to their physycal and behavour characteristics.
